      The Personal Care Aide assists with patient care throughout nursing areas under the direction of licensed personnel.
      In the execution of job duties, it is the universal expectation that all tasks are performed with a patient centered focus, while also seeking opportunities to continually improve core processes. Incumbent will be scheduled based on operational need, which may include but is not limited to: holidays, extended shifts, night and/or weekend shifts, standby and/or on-call.


      Reports to: Resident Care Director; Nursing Supervisor
      FLSA: Non-exempt
      Education: High school diploma; PCA training program with Certificate or Nurse Aide educational program; Nursing Aides who have completed the required education but not obtained state licensure will be in PCA role.
      Licenses: PCA certificate from PCA training program, or completion of Nurse Aide educational program
      Certifications: None listed
      Minimum Work Experience: PCA Experience Preferred


      Required Skills: Requires critical thinking skills, decisive judgment and the ability to work with minimal supervision. Must be able to work in a stressful environment and take appropriate action.


      Essential Functions
      Assists patient with activities of daily living (ADLs) and documents accordingly. Assists patient with feeding and/or meals as assigned and documents accordingly. Assists patient with elimination needs as is appropriate and documents accordingly.
      Answers alarm pendants and respond to residents'/patients’ needs appropriately and promptly.
      Collects and documents patient information as needed (including weights and vital signs). Reports abnormal findings or changes in physical, mental, and emotional conditions to nursing staff. Provides restorative care per plan of care. Documents accordingly.
      Assists with keeping patient rooms and common areas stocked, clean and orderly. Changes linens of occupied / unoccupied beds.
      Demonstrates proper infection control practice and adheres to Infection Control Policies and Procedures and OSHA standards. Operates all equipment and performs all procedures/care in a safe manner. Reports faulty and/or dangerous equipment as necessary
      Assists in discharge process of patients to include: transport, packing of personal belongings, and assistance with hygiene needs as requested. Provides for safe transport of patients through the institution. Appropriate measures are taken to escort patients into and out of the facility.
      Assists with postmortem care including transport to the morgue.
